I have been trying to get an Adaptec 2940W working with 3 SCSI-2 devices. None of the devices are wide, but I was under the understanding that the 2940W could handle either or BOTH. The devices I am trying to get running are: Micropolis 4110S 1.02 Gig Hard Drive (ID 1) Teac CD-50 CDROM (ID 4) Conner CFP1080S 1.03 Gig Hard Drive (ID 6) The problem I am having is when the SCSI bus gets a lot of activity (ie compiliation or file copying), I get Timeout errors. I have tried various things to try and find the problem. Lowering the Sync Rate, Disabling Sync Negotiation, and Disabling Disconnection. I have also tried eliminating different devices, but no matter what I try I get timeout errors. I had a 2940 (no wide) in the machine for a little while (the place where I bought it, sent me the wrong one by mistake), and I didn't have any problem with that card. Is there anyone out there with a 2940W that has had success??
